ENSTO Zacisk CLAMPOPRO 1‑pole gray Al/Cu 35–150 mm² KE63 is a single‑pole terminal clamp designed for mechanical and electrical connection of aluminum and copper conductors with cross‑sections from 35 to 150 mm². The connector is intended for use in power distribution and industrial installations where reliable conductor fixation and corrosion‑resistant contact between dissimilar metals are required. The gray body and compact form factor allow mounting in overhead line fittings, cable joints and distribution hardware while maintaining electrical continuity and mechanical stability.
The clamp provides secure mechanical retention and a low‑resistance electrical contact for both Al and Cu conductors, reducing the risk of galvanic corrosion at the interface. Its design enables straightforward installation and consistent contact pressure across the conductor cross‑section range, supporting long‑term service in outdoor and indoor environments. Constructed from materials selected for conductivity and corrosion resistance, the product supports maintenance access and reliable performance under typical power distribution conditions.
Strip the conductor insulation to the length recommended for the chosen clamp, ensuring clean, undamaged conductor ends. Position the aluminum and/or copper conductors in the clamp so that they make full contact with the contact surfaces, then tighten the fastening element to the torque specified by installation standards or project documentation to achieve secure mechanical and electrical connection. Verify mechanical retention and continuity after installation and, where applicable, apply appropriate sealing or protective measures for outdoor or exposed installations.
Use torque values and installation procedures referenced in local electrical codes and ENSTO installation guidance; avoid over‑tightening to prevent conductor deformation and under‑tightening that may increase contact resistance. When connecting dissimilar metals, ensure proper contact surfaces and consider corrosion prevention practices compatible with Al/Cu interfaces.
